Don't Forget the Main Ingredient

I travel to many churches as a guest speaker or trainer and am very often stunned by how little need there is for Bibles in most children's ministries. I consider  teaching with and out of a Bible to be the fundamental basis of my teaching.
 
I use puppets, object lessons, media clips, illusions, etc.  You-name-it, I've used it... to creatively teach and engage children, but never as a replacement or substitute for teaching with and out of a Bible. Only the Bible has God's promise of effectiveness. And yet, the Bible is a rare object in many children's ministries today. This is a tragedy.

I don't care how attractive your ministry facility is, how innovative your program, how creative your teaching - if you are neglecting to teach kids the value of God's Word by example (teaching with and from it) you are teaching them a lesson: that the Bible really isn't that important.

Seminary to succeed?
Seminary to succeed?
Karl Bastian writes, "I got a Facebook message today from a children's pastor with an interesting question. His church is encouraging him to pursue a seminary degree but he wasn't convinced he needed to. 

As he looked over the landscape of 'successful' children ministry professionals, his assumption was that many didn't have seminary degrees -- and that didn't seem to hinder their success in ministry.

Here's what I shared with him in case others are wrestling with that difficult decision..."
